Ingredients for Pumpkin Cinnamon Rolls

You’ll find most of these ingredients in your pantry, with just a few seasonal touches.

Exact Ingredients with Measurements

Dough:

  • All-purpose flour – 4 cups (500 g), plus extra for dusting
  • Pumpkin puree – ¾ cup (180 g)
  • Whole milk (warm) – ½ cup (120 ml)
  • Granulated sugar – ½ cup (100 g)
  • Unsalted butter (melted) – ⅓ cup (75 g)
  • Large egg – 1
  • Instant yeast – 2 ¼ teaspoons (1 packet)
  • Salt – 1 teaspoon (6 g)
  • Ground cinnamon – 1 teaspoon
  • Ground nutmeg – ½ teaspoon
  • Ground ginger – ¼ teaspoon

Filling:

  • Brown sugar – ⅔ cup (130 g)
  • Ground cinnamon – 1 tablespoon
  • Unsalted butter (softened) – ¼ cup (60 g)

Frosting:

  • Cream cheese (softened) – 4 ounces (113 g)
  • Unsalted butter (softened) – ¼ cup (60 g)
  • Powdered sugar – 1 cup (120 g)
  • Vanilla extract – 1 teaspoon

Step-by-Step: How to Make Pumpkin Cinnamon Rolls

Making the Dough

In a small bowl, whisk warm milk with sugar and sprinkle the yeast over it. Let it sit for 5–10 minutes until foamy. In a large bowl or stand mixer, combine pumpkin puree, melted butter, egg, and spices. Add the yeast mixture and mix well. Gradually add flour and salt, mixing until a soft dough forms. Knead the dough for about 5–7 minutes until smooth and elastic.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over with a towel, and let rise in a warm place for 1–2 hours until doubled in size.

Rolling and Filling

Punch down the dough and roll it into a large rectangle (about 14×18 inches). Spread softened butter evenly over the surface. Mix brown sugar and cinnamon in a small bowl, then sprinkle over the buttered dough. Starting from one long side, roll the dough tightly into a log. Slice into 12 even rolls.

Baking and Frosting

Arrange the rolls in a greased 9×13 pan. Cover and let rise for another 30–45 minutes.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and bake for 25–30 minutes until golden brown.

Meanwhile, beat cream cheese and butter until smooth. Add powdered sugar and vanilla, mixing until fluffy. Spread frosting over warm rolls before serving.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Making Pumpkin Roll Recipes

  • Adding too much flour — keep the dough slightly sticky for soft rolls.
  • Skipping the second rise — this ensures fluffy rolls.
  • Overbaking — check at 25 minutes to prevent dry rolls.
  • Using pumpkin pie filling instead of puree — they’re not the same!

Expert Tips for Perfect Pumpkin Spice Cinnamon Rolls

Make sure your yeast is fresh for the best rise. For even more fall flavor, add a sprinkle of pumpkin pie spice to the filling. You can also prep the rolls the night before and refrigerate; bake them in the morning for a fresh, warm treat.

Recipe Variations: Pumpkin Roll Recipe Ideas You’ll Love

  • Maple Frosting: Replace vanilla with maple syrup for a deeper fall flavor.
  • Nuts or Raisins: Sprinkle chopped pecans or raisins in the filling.
  • Mini Pumpkin Rolls: Cut smaller portions for bite-sized treats.
  • Pumpkin Pie Cinnamon Rolls: Add a thin layer of pumpkin pie spice-sweetened puree to the filling for more pumpkin flavor.

How to Store Pumpkin Cinnamon Rolls and Reheat

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days, or in the fridge for up to 5 days. To reheat, warm in the microwave for 15–20 seconds or in a 300°F oven for 10 minutes.

FAQs About Pumpkin Cinnamon Rolls

Can I freeze them?
Yes — freeze baked, unfrosted rolls for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ight and frost before serving.

Can I make them dairy-free?
Use plant-based butter and a vegan cream cheese alternative for the frosting.

Do I have to use cream cheese frosting?
Not at all — a simple vanilla glaze works beautifully, too.
